Rod Freeman

Vp, Customer Success | Construction And Property Category at Globality

Rod Freeman is an accomplished business leader with extensive experience in customer success, strategic sourcing, and management within the construction and property sectors. Currently serving as VP of Customer Success for Globality, Inc., since June 2021, Rod has also founded and operates Small Biz Up. Prior roles include Practice Leader at Deloitte Consulting, where market offerings in sourcing-as-a-managed-service were developed. Previously, Rod led strategic sourcing initiatives at Accenture and managed supply chain programs at IBM, growing expertise in facilities management and construction. Educational background includes a Bachelor's degree in Mechanical Engineering from Columbia Engineering and a Master's degree in Management from Rensselaer Polytechnic Institute.

Location

Cheektowaga, United States

Links

Previous companies


Org chart

No direct reports

Teams


Offices

This person is not in any offices